How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Milford?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Milford Studio Apartments | $1,567 | $1,559 | $1,584 |
Milford 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,755 | $670 | $2,404 |
Milford 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,104 | $728 | $3,373 |
Milford 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,539 | $1,165 | $3,395 |

Largest Available Milford and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
The largest available 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Milford, VA is found at Acclaim at the Hill in the Lee's Parke Estates neighborhood and is 1,171 square feet priced from $2,114. The Walker Virginia Center has the second largest 1 Bedroom, which is sized at 902 square feet and currently listed start at $1,890. Cheapest Available Milford and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
As of May 20, 2025 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Milford, VA is the 1BR Model starting from $1,331 at New Post Apartments in the River Bend neighborhood. The second most affordable Milford 1 Bedroom is the 1 BEDROOM - 1B Model at Orchard Ridge at Jackson Village starting at $1,439 in the Lee's Parke Estates neighborhood.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Milford is currently $1,755.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in Milford:
